			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>All this talk about hips a few days back, has gotten me in the mood for belly dancing!  I wanted to share <a href="http://youtube=http//youtube.com/watch?v=XJP5Zs_k8Yo" target="_blank">this video</a> I found on youtube, the dancer is Aziza Mor.</p>
<p>A few years ago, a tanguero that I know, upon learning that I was belly dancing, asked me if it was just a bunch of jiggling around. Heavens no!  Belly dancing is not that simple.  Look at the video and see how she uses her core, her hips, see her strength.</p>
<p>Belly dancing is <strong><em>NOT</em></strong>:</p>
<p>-loose and jiggly in movement, lacking technique</p>
<p>-submissive</p>
<p>-simple &amp; easy</p>
<p>-tawdry</p>
<p>-meant only as a way for woman to seduce men (don&#8217;t believe me? Read <a href="http://shira.net/whole-family.htm" target="_blank">this</a>.)</p>
<p>Belly Dancing <strong><em>IS</em></strong>:</p>
<p>-very good for your core muscles</p>
<p>-good for stress relief  (at the end of a hard day, put on a coin scarf and shimmy for a while. Works wonders.)</p>
<p>-a celebration of<em></em> fertility (&#8230;in a lot of other languages, it translates to &#8220;dance of the womb&#8221;)</p>
<p>-a celebration of sisterhood</p>
<p>-sensual (and yes, seductive)</p>
<p>-grounded</p>
<p>-empowering</p>
<p>-a beautiful way to celebrate your individuality and express yourself!</p>
<p>-a good excuse to make pretty costumes with sparkly jingly things</p>
<p>-for all age groups, all body types</p>
<p>-part of several cultures that are fascinating to learn about</p>
